Pros

FINRA Great Company they have a strong, supportive culture, Professional growth, I liked the people I worked with, loved going to work every day and the challenges. But most of all it's what they stand for Protecting the Investors.

Cons

Changes within management, and Office politics are a risk at any company, however, at a large company where it is difficult to stand out, backbiting may be a way of life. It’s difficult to change the culture of such a company, so if you don’t like game-playing be sure you understand the corporate culture before you make a commitment to any company.

Pros

Some of the nicest and most helpful people, but fewer as they keep getting laid off or pushed out because of toxic leadership. The mission is a high priority for some. Great place to work for a very short time, then go.

Cons

Poor leadership, constantly changing without taking any time to understand impacts. Decisions only benefit a small group of friends who only respect other former FBI agents and their contributions. Morale is in the gutter and it comes off as intentional. Women are disappearing from management ranks and only tolerated as long as they are agreeable. People get resources based on popularity with the in group so some teams burn out while others have little to do.
